I have seen posts about this is the web and in a couple newgroups, but I
have seen no clear solutions or definition as to what this message means.

When i run gdb, I get warning: unable to find dynamic linker
breakpoint function.
GDB will be unable to debug shared library initializers and track
explicitly loaded dynamic code.

I have installed the latest gdb and gcc.

Minimally, to duplicate this error, I compile with:
g++ -g test.cpp

Then to debug, I run:
gdb a.out

In the debugger when I try to run, is when I get the error.

Anybody care to point out what the cause of this is ?
